Planting Calendar for Perilla

Frost tolerance for perilla: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ost.

It's probably a bad idea to plant perilla until after all chance of frost has passed because they are not cold tolerant.

The earliest that you can plant perilla in Delta is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ant perilla and expect a good harvest is probably August. Any later than that and your perilla may not have a chance to really do well. If you are starting your perilla ind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a little bit ear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Delta the average date of last frost happens on April 15. In the coldest months of winter you can expect an average low temperature of -5°F.

Since the USDA zone info for Delta may not be accurate from year to year the actual date of last frost is different every year. Since half of the time in Delta you get a frost after April 15 be ready to cover your perilla in the event of a late frost.
